Gabrielle Giffords) Mark Kelly has been temporarily replaced in his duties as an astronaut so he can stay with his wife—Gabrielle Giffords. Kelly has been at his wife's bedside since last weekend's shooting, but he's scheduled to command the shuttle Endeavour when it blasts off in April. The crew needs to keep training, so NASA picked Frederick Sturckow to replace Kelly for now, Spaceflight Now reports. It will decide later whether Kelly will sit out the mission.
